Output 8fee854f6767b04abc6d8feefcd19fd71ea7f82262f306150bfb7b89cda30e17:132

value
38038568
script pubkey
OP_0 OP_PUSHBYTES_20 8b3207e035a8149f0ba5d7a50e2ed2e87d6c89ae
address
bc1q3veq0cp44q2f7za967jsutkjap7kezdwd4dwru
transaction
8fee854f6767b04abc6d8feefcd19fd71ea7f82262f306150bfb7b89cda30e17